## Ownership: Log Compaction

The compaction subsystem in Brimflow merges segment files once retention thresholds are met, and any change here risks silent message loss. Reviewers should verify that tombstone handling, offset preservation, and the dedup index rebuild are all covered by the soak tests before approving. Compaction changes require a second reviewer without exception. The engineer accountable for this module and final sign-off is listed below.

named custodian: Brivan Eliath Quenox Frador

### Step 6 — Deploy the rounding patch

This release of LedgerSpan corrects half-cent drift in multi-hop currency conversion by switching to banker's rounding at each hop. Verify the reconciliation report shows zero net drift across the Torvane test ledger before promoting. Because the patch touches settlement math, the artifact requires dual sign-off. For your verification pass, the build was signed with the following deploy key.

signing key of bagap-yawep = bky13_TbfT6ZMUoGJo2

Handover Note — Product-Line Retirement

From: Director Maswell. To: Director Obrek.

The Tarnholm appliance line will be retired at the end of Q4. Remaining inventory is committed to the Pellway clearance channel; supplier contracts wind down in parallel. Service obligations run a further eighteen months. Board materials are drafted and filed. The confidential note on successor plans appears directly below.

management briefing: Casvanek Logistics plans to lower the Druox list price by 49.1 percent in April. The board signed off on a budget of $16.5 million for Project Rusath. The renewal with Kasvanix Partners closes at $67.9 million a year, 33.9 percent above the last contract. Project Casath slips by one quarter because of the staffing delay.

Squatwatch scans our internal package mirror for typo-squatting lookalikes and quarantines suspicious uploads. As a reviewer, check that detection-rule changes include test fixtures covering both the legitimate name and the confusable variant, and that the scanner's allowlist diff is justified in the PR description. Every merged rule pack is built and signed by the pipeline before mirrors pull it; unsigned packs are silently ignored by agents. When validating a pack locally, verify it against the signing key that follows.

release key, hadug-kawef: bky13_mPGeFZeR1GZ1G